I've read other posts about gearbox oil dripping out of the "GEARBOX VENT" when storing some 60'MMM's in the vertical position. I've looked but couldn't see the vent...maybe it's these 56yr old eyes...can anyone help??? .....also was wondering if anyone has any suggestions on how to relieve tension on mower deck belt as suggested in owners manual....is it really necessary????????

You can only store the BX deck one way with the roller wheel kit.... Mine hasn't leaked in 6 weeks and I also don't see a traditional vent any where on the gear box. As for the belt, use a very large and long screwdriver and pry the spring off of the mounting post as if you were removing a brake return spring. If you have never worked on automobile brakes, then you won't know what I am referring to. Then just try to coax the belt off of one of the pulleys. Use wire to retain the spring to the deck so it doesn't get lost...

I took the tension off my belt a week or so ago. I used a 2 foot peice of 2X2 as a lever and a length of rope with a hook to grab the spring. It came off very easy. I think it will be just as easy to put it back on. Another TBNer recommended the method; might have been Henro.

I've have my mower stored on end and no leaks.
